With the rapid development of the construction industry, large bridges and highways and other infrastructure, concrete has shown explosive growth. The hydration heat of concrete needs to be reduced during the molding process. Too high a temperature will cause water to evaporate too quickly, accelerate the hydration reaction, condense quickly, and easily cause cold seams. Traditional cooling methods mainly use ice machines to cool down with ice cubes. Screw chillers are simple to install, have sufficient cooling capacity, shorten the cooling time, and the refrigeration unit can provide a constant and stable temperature. The chiller adjustment range is normal temperature (5℃-30℃) to ensure the stability of water delivery.
